Chain-wielding man allegedly smashes driver’s windshield

Published 2:57 pm Saturday, June 30, 2012

Two Minnesota men are in the Mower County jail for allegedly blocking a driver’s path and smashing his hood and windshield with a chain.

Preston Ray Bain, 21, of Waseca and Christopher J. Heimsness, 38, of Rochester, are both charged with felony intentional damage to property of more than $1,000. Bain pleaded not guilty on Friday. Heimsness will make his initial appearance on July 12.

According to the court complaint, the victim immediately drove his ‘98 Chevy Camaro to the Law Enforcement Center in Austin and reported the vandalism. The victim told officers both men were sitting on a trailer in the 1800 block of Fourth St. NE and drinking beer and blocked the victim’s path when he tried to drive past. An officer went with the victim to locate the suspects and arrested both Bain and Heimsness. Bain gave a preliminary breath test of .178, and Heimsness registered .115.

Though the victim is OK, his car sustained more than $4,000 worth of damage to the windshield and hood, according to the complaint.
